Where to Buy Over-The-Counter Medication in Italy
In Italy, the sale of pharmaceuticals is greatly regulated. Medications are categorized mainly based on whether they need a prescription (ricetta) or not.
1. The Pharmacy (Farmacia)
The main and most trusted place to purchase OTC medication in Italy is the traditional drug store. Easily recognizable by a radiant green or red cross sign outside, Italian pharmacies are pillars of the neighborhood.
2. The Para-Pharmacy (Parafarmacia)
Introduced more just recently to increase competition and ease of access, para-pharmacies sell OTC medications, natural remedies, cosmetics, and homeopathic products, however they can not sell prescription-only drugs.
3. Night and Duty Pharmacies (Farmacia di Turno)
For emergencies beyond regular company hours, Italy operates a turning system of responsibility pharmacies (farmacie di turno).

4. Are pharmacists in Italy allowed to speak English?
In significant tourist locations, historic centers, and large cities (such as Rome, Milan, Florence, and Venice ), pharmacists regularly speak conversational English. In smaller sized rural towns, communication might need a translation app or standard Italian expressions. 5. Can I bring my own medication into Italy from abroad? Yes. Travelers are usually enabled to bring an individual supply of prescription and OTC medications into Italy.
